總結:
排序演算法維基百科
經典排序演算法 - 快速排序quick sort
經典排序演算法 - 桶排序bucket sort
經典排序演算法 - 插入排序insertion sort
經典排序演算法 - 基數排序radix sort
經典排序演算法 - 鴿巢排序pigeonhole sort
經典排序演算法 - 歸併排序merge sort
經典排序演算法 - 氣泡排序bubble sort
經典排序演算法 - 選擇排序selection sort
經典排序演算法 - 雞尾酒排序cocktail sort
經典排序演算法 - 希爾排序shell sort
經典排序演算法 - 堆排序heap sort序
經典排序演算法 - 地精排序gnome sort
經典排序演算法 - 奇偶排序odd-even sort
經典排序演算法 - 梳排序comb sort
經典排序演算法 - 耐心排序patience sorting
經典排序演算法 - 珠排序bead sort
經典排序演算法 - 計數排序counting sort
新增經典排序演算法 - proxmap sort
經典排序演算法 - flash sort
經典排序演算法 - strand sort
經典排序演算法 - 圈排序cycle sort
經典排序演算法 - 圖書館排序(library sort)
排序演算法總結
用於開拓視野與思路,學習程式設計技巧,為學習高階演算法打基礎。
基礎演算法 排序(一)
氣泡排序的基本思路是 它重複地走訪過要排序的元素列,依次比較兩個相鄰的元素,如果他們的順序 如從大到小 首字母從a到z 錯誤就把他們交換過來。走訪元素的工作是重複地進行直到沒有相鄰元素需要交換,也就是說該元素列已經排序完成。氣泡排序總的平均時間複雜度為o n2 public static void ...
基礎演算法 排序 一
排序可以說時最基礎的演算法之一,排序就是將資料按照某種邏輯重新排列的過程,比如從大到小排序 從小到大排序 排序非常常見比如有購物車物品的排序 歷史訂單的排序等等 演算法我們比較關心的主要有兩點 時間複雜度與空間複雜度,排序演算法一樣 這篇文章只介紹幾種基本的排序演算法 氣泡排序 插入排序 選擇排序 ...
一 基礎排序演算法
一 氣泡排序 氣泡排序是可用的最慢的排序演算法之一,但是它也是最容易理解和實現的一種排序演算法。這種排序的得名是由與數值 像氣泡一樣 從序列的一端浮動到另外一端。假設現在要把一列數按公升序的方式進行排序,將較大的數值浮動到右側,而小的浮動到左側。這種效果可以通過氣泡排序來實現,具體 如下 首先新建乙...